Open In App

Semrush Vs SpyFu | Which Is the Best Tool In 2024?

Last Updated : 04 Mar, 2024
Improve
Improve
Like Article
Like
Save
Share
Report

Semrush and SpyFu are two important players in SEO and digital marketing analytics, offering a range of features and capabilities to help businesses enhance their online presence. In this article, we will thoroughly compare Semrush and SpyFu, examining their key attributes such as pricing, features, user interface, data accuracy, customer support, and overall performance. Choosing between them can be daunting, as both offer many features and cater to specific needs. This comprehensive analysis delves into the strengths and weaknesses of Semrush and SpyFu, helping you make an informed decision based on your requirements.

Semrush-Vs-SpyFu

Semrush Vs SpyFu

What is Semrush?

Semrush, founded in 2008, is like the wise old owl of the SEO world. It offers a complete suite of tools for keyword research, competitor analysis, and more. With over a decade of experience, Semrush has earned a solid reputation in the digital marketing realm.

What is SpyFu?

SpyFu, on the other hand, is the suave underdog, bursting onto the scene in 2005. Specializing in competitive intelligence, SpyFu provides insights into your competitors’ strategies, keywords, and ad campaigns. Its mission is to help you spy on the competition (in a legal way).

Semrush vs. SpyFu: Detailed Comparison Table

Feature

Semrush

SpyFu

Core Focus

All-in-one SEO toolsuite

Competitor analysis for SEO & PPC

Keyword Research

Extensive, with keyword difficulty, search volume, global capabilities, & keyword suggestions

Decent, with keyword suggestions & search volume, but lacks depth & global capabilities

Competitor Analysis

Robust, including organic & paid search insights, historical data, keyword tracking, & social media analytics

In-depth, with historical data, keyword tracking, & user-friendly interface, but lacks social media insights

Backlink Monitoring

Comprehensive, with link building opportunities, link quality analysis, lost/broken link identification, & competitor backlink analysis

Limited, backlink checker only, lacks link building tools, quality analysis, & competitor backlink features

On-Page SEO

Site audit tool with improvement suggestions & keyword-based on-page SEO recommendations

Limited, no dedicated features, but indirectly helps by analyzing competitors’ websites

Social Media

Social media management tools for scheduling posts, tracking engagement, & competitor analysis

None

Content Marketing

Content marketing tools for topic research, content creation suggestions, & plagiarism checker

None

Reporting & Analytics

Extensive reporting & customizable dashboards

Limited reporting options

User Interface

Can be overwhelming for beginners due to vast features, but has tutorials & resources

Generally user-friendly and intuitive

Customer Support

Live chat, email, and phone support

Email support and knowledge base resources

Pricing (Monthly)

$129.95 (Basic) – $449.95 (Business)

$33 (Basic) – $199 (Team)

Free Trial

Yes

Yes

Best for

• Businesses with diverse SEO needs

• Those needing in-depth historical competitor data & advanced features

• Businesses focused on SEO & PPC competitor analysis

• Beginners due to user-friendly interface

• Smaller budgets

Core Focus

  • Semrush: Semrush positions itself as a comprehensive SEO toolkit, aiming to serve as a one-stop shop for various digital marketing and SEO needs. It includes features that go beyond traditional SEO analysis and optimization.
  • SpyFu: SpyFu is primarily a competitor analysis tool. Its focus lies in providing in-depth insights into competitors’ SEO and PPC strategies, helping users identify growth opportunities through reverse engineering successful tactics.

Keyword Research

Semrush

  • Global Capabilities: Go beyond your local market and explore keyword opportunities in international markets. This is crucial for businesses targeting audiences beyond their geographical borders.
  • Keyword Difficulty Score: Gauge the level of competition for specific keywords, allowing you to prioritize your efforts and target keywords with attainable ranking potential. This data-driven approach helps you formulate realistic strategies and optimize your content for keywords that offer a healthy balance between search volume and difficulty.
  • Keyword Magic Tool: Explore a vast database of keyword suggestions, related terms, and long-tail variations, enabling you to create a comprehensive keyword portfolio that targets both primary and secondary search terms. This comprehensive approach helps you capture potential user searches across various stages of the buying journey.
  • Organic Search Positions Tracker: Monitor your website’s ranking for a designated list of keywords over time, providing valuable insights into the effectiveness of your SEO efforts and allowing you to identify areas for improvement.

SpyFu

  • Keyword Difficulty Estimation: While not as comprehensive as Semrush’s dedicated score, SpyFu provides a basic difficulty rating based on the number of competing websites. This can be a helpful starting point for gauging keyword competitiveness, especially for users prioritizing a simpler interface.
  • Historical Keyword Data: Analyze how competitors’ keyword rankings have changed over time, revealing insights into their evolving strategies and helping you identify trending keywords and topics that might present valuable opportunities.
  • Organic Search Click Share: Analyze the estimated percentage of clicks a competitor receives for specific keywords. This data, while an approximation, can offer clues about the effectiveness of their content and PPC campaigns, potentially inspiring your optimization efforts.

While both tools provide access to keyword data, Semrush offers a more sophisticated suite with a global focus, advanced difficulty scoring, and a wider range of keyword research tools, making it ideal for users seeking detailed insights and strategic keyword planning. SpyFu, on the other hand, caters more towards those who prioritize user-friendliness and are primarily interested in competitor-focused keyword research and historical data analysis.

Competitor Analysis

Semrush

  • Domain vs. Subdomain Analysis: Compare your website’s performance against specific competitor subdomains, allowing for granular analysis of individual sections like blog pages or product categories. This level of detail helps you assess specific weaknesses and identify areas for improvement compared to your direct competitors within their website.
  • Gap Analysis: Identify keyword gaps by comparing your ranking keywords with those of your competitors. This reveals opportunities to target relevant keywords that your competitors are missing, potentially expanding your reach and attracting new audiences.
  • Paid Search Insights: Uncover your competitors’ paid advertising strategies, including their ad copy, keywords, and landing pages. This data can be invaluable for crafting effective PPC campaigns that resonate with your target audience, drawing inspiration from successful competitor approaches.
  • Social Media Comparison: Analyze your competitors’ social media presence, including their follower base, engagement metrics, and content strategy. Utilize this information to optimize your own social media efforts and identify potential areas where you can outperform your competitors.

SpyFu

  • SERP History: View historical snapshots of search engine results pages (SERPs) for specific keywords, revealing how the ranking landscape has evolved over time. This data can be useful for understanding ranking trends, identifying emerging competitors, and adapting your strategy to changing market dynamics.
  • PPC Keyword History: Analyze the historical PPC campaigns of your competitors, including their keyword usage, ad spend, and landing pages. This can shed light on their PPC strategies over time and provide valuable insights for optimizing your own pay-per-click campaigns.
  • Keyword Difficulty Trends: Track the changing difficulty level of specific keywords over time, allowing you to prioritize keywords that are becoming easier to rank for while avoiding those with increasing difficulty. This data-driven approach helps you make informed decisions about your keyword targeting strategy.

Both tools offer powerful competitor analysis features, but Semrush leans towards a broader approach with additional functionalities like social media comparison and subdomain analysis. SpyFu, however, excels in providing historical data and insights specifically tailored to competitor research, making it a valuable tool for uncovering historical trends and uncovering hidden opportunities within PPC strategies.

Backlink Monitoring

Semrush

  • Backlink Quality Score: Analyze the authority and quality of backlinks, helping you prioritize high-quality links and avoid low-quality or spammy backlinks that can potentially harm your website’s SEO performance. This data-driven approach allows you to focus on building backlinks from reputable sources and maintain a healthy backlink profile.
  • Backlink Alerts: Receive notifications whenever your website gains or loses backlinks, enabling you to stay informed about your backlink profile and take necessary actions, such as reaching out to websites that have removed your link or potentially taking action against malicious backlinks.
  • Link Building Tools: Utilize Semrush’s suite of link-building tools to identify potential link-building opportunities from relevant websites, analyze competitor backlink profiles, and track your link-building progress. These features streamline the link-building process and help you acquire high-quality backlinks that enhance your website’s authority and search engine ranking potential.

SpyFu

  • Limited Backlink Analysis: While offering a backlink checker, SpyFu lacks the in-depth analysis features present in Semrush. It can provide a basic overview of a website’s backlink profile but lacks functionalities like quality score, backlink alerts, and dedicated link-building tools.

While both tools offer the ability to check backlinks, Semrush goes far beyond by offering a comprehensive suite of backlink analysis, monitoring, and building tools. This makes it ideal for users who prioritize building a strong backlink profile and want to actively manage their link acquisition strategies.

On-Page SEO

Semrush

  • On-Page SEO Checker: Conduct a comprehensive website audit to identify technical SEO issues, broken links, and areas for improvement related to page speed, mobile-friendliness, and content optimization. This helps you ensure your website is technically sound and optimized for search engines, laying a solid foundation for successful rankings.
  • Topic Research Tool: Generate topic clusters and subtopics based on your seed keyword, aiding in content creation and ensuring your content comprehensively addresses various aspects of a specific topic. This empowers you to create informative and engaging content that caters to different user search queries and intent.
  • Content Audit Tool: Analyze your existing website content and identify areas for improvement in terms of keyword optimization, readability, and topical relevance. This helps you refine your existing content and ensure it aligns with current SEO best practices and user expectations.

SpyFu

  • Limited On-Page SEO Features: SpyFu primarily focuses on competitor analysis and lacks dedicated on-page SEO optimization tools. However, you can indirectly utilize competitor analysis to identify potential on-page improvements.
  • Analyze Top-Ranking Pages: Analyze the content structure, headings, and keyword usage of top-ranking competitor pages to gain insights into effective on-page SEO practices within your niche.

Semrush takes the lead in on-page SEO by offering a dedicated suite of tools for technical SEO auditing, content optimization suggestions, and topic research. This comprehensive approach empowers you to optimize your website’s structure, content, and technical aspects for improved search engine performance and user satisfaction.

Social Media

Semrush

  • Social Media Management Tools: Schedule posts, track engagement metrics, and analyze competitor activity across various social media platforms. This allows you to manage your social media presence more efficiently, understand what resonates with your audience, and learn from successful competitor strategies.

SpyFu

  • Lacks social media features: Its focus remains solely on SEO and PPC competitor analysis.

While SpyFu lacks social media functionalities, Semrush offers a comprehensive suite for managing your social media presence and gaining insights into competitors’ social media strategies. This can be valuable for businesses that actively engage on social media and aim to optimize their social media efforts for wider reach and brand awareness.

Content Marketing

Semrush

  • Content Market Research Tool: Identify trending topics, analyze your competitors’ content strategy, and discover high-performing content formats within your niche. This data empowers you to create content that aligns with audience preferences and market trends, potentially increasing engagement and attracting organic traffic.
  • Content Creation Suggestions: Receive suggestions for content titles, outlines, and related topics based on your seed keywords and target audience. This can streamline your content creation process and ensure you’re covering relevant and valuable topics for your audience.
  • Plagiarism Checker: Ensure your content is original and avoid copyright infringement by checking for plagiarism before publishing.

SpyFu

  • Lacks content marketing features: Its focus remains on SEO and PPC competitor analysis.

Semrush provides valuable tools for content marketing by offering insights into audience preferences, content strategy suggestions, and plagiarism checking capabilities. This comprehensive approach can save marketing teams time and effort by providing data-driven recommendations for creating engaging and original content.

Reporting & Analytics

Semrush

  • Extensive Reporting: Generate detailed reports on various aspects of your SEO performance, including keyword rankings, backlink profile, social media engagement, and on-page SEO audits. This data helps you track progress, identify areas for improvement, and demonstrate the impact of your SEO efforts to stakeholders.
  • Customizable Dashboards: Tailor your dashboards to include the most relevant metrics for your needs, enabling you to visualize your SEO performance at a glance and quickly identify trends and patterns.

SpyFu

  • Limited Reporting Options: Offers basic reports on competitor keywords and backlink data, with less customization options.

While both tools offer some level of reporting, Semrush delivers a more comprehensive and customizable experience. This can be crucial for businesses that need detailed insights into their SEO performance across various channels and require data-driven evidence for decision-making. SpyFu’s reporting options are more basic, catering to users who primarily need a quick overview of specific competitor-related data.

User Interface (UI)

Semrush

  • Can be overwhelming for beginners: The vast array of features and functionalities can be intimidating for users new to SEO. However, Semrush offers tutorials, resources, and a learning academy to help users navigate the platform effectively.

SpyFu

  • Generally user-friendly and intuitive: The interface is designed for ease of use, making it relatively easy for beginners to start utilizing the tool and glean valuable insights.

The choice between these two options depends on your level of experience and comfort with complex interfaces. If you’re new to SEO, SpyFu’s user-friendly interface might be more appealing. However, if you’re comfortable mastering a comprehensive toolkit and value the benefits of extensive features, Semrush can be a powerful asset.

Customer Support

Semrush

  • Offers multiple support channels: Provides live chat, email, and phone support, ensuring users have access to assistance when needed.

SpyFu

  • Limited support options: Primarily offers email support and knowledge base resources.

While both tools offer support, Semrush provides more comprehensive options with access to live chat and phone support, which can be helpful for users needing immediate assistance with specific issues.

Pricing (Monthly)

Semrush

  • Tiered pricing structure: Offers varying plans with different features and limitations based on the chosen plan. Prices start at $129.95 per month for the Pro plan and can reach $449.95 per month for the Business plan.

SpyFu

  • Tiered pricing structure: Also offers varying plans with different functionalities at different price points. Costs range from $33 per month for the Basic plan to $199 per month for the Team plan.

Semrush, with its broader feature set, tends to be more expensive than SpyFu. However, the specific cost depends on the chosen plan and the features required for your specific needs.

Best For

Semrush

  • Businesses with diverse SEO needs.
  • Those requiring in-depth historical competitor data and advanced features like on-page SEO optimization and social media management.
  • Users comfortable navigating a comprehensive user interface.
  • Teams requiring access to various customer support channels, including live chat and phone support.

SpyFu

  • Businesses focused on SEO and PPC competitor analysis.
  • Beginners due to its user-friendly interface.
  • Smaller budgets seeking a cost-effective option.
  • Users who primarily need basic competitor insights and backlink checking functionalities.

Choosing Between Semrush and SpyFu

Selecting the right tool between Semrush and SpyFu depends entirely on your specific needs and priorities. Here’s a breakdown to help you make an informed choice:

Start by considering your primary goals:

  • Are you primarily focused on in-depth competitor analysis for SEO and PPC campaigns?: If so, SpyFu might be a good fit. Its user-friendly interface and historical data focus can be beneficial for gaining insights into competitor strategies.
  • Do you need a comprehensive SEO toolkit that covers various aspects like keyword research, on-page SEO optimization, backlink monitoring, and social media analytics? – If so, Semrush is the better choice. Its extensive feature set caters to diverse SEO needs and offers advanced functionalities for optimizing your website and online presence.

Further considerations:

  • Level of Experience:
    • Beginner: SpyFu’s user-friendly interface is easier to navigate.
    • Intermediate/Advanced: You might find Semrush’s comprehensive features more beneficial, despite the steeper learning curve.
  • Budget:
    • Limited Budget: SpyFu offers more affordable plans.
    • Larger Budget: Semrush’s advanced features might justify its higher pricing for businesses with extensive SEO needs.
  • Team Size:
    • Smaller Team: SpyFu can suffice for basic competitor research.
    • Larger Team: Semrush caters to more complex needs and potentially multiple users with its various support options.

Conclusion

In the battle of Semrush vs. SpyFu, the right tool for you ultimately depends on your specific needs and preferences. Whether you value data accuracy, robust customer support, lightning-fast performance, or a combination of these factors, both Semrush and SpyFu offer valuable features to help you achieve your SEO goals. So, weigh your options carefully and choose the tool that aligns best with your objectives for success in 2024 and beyond!In conclusion, both Semrush and SpyFu are formidable tools that cater to the diverse needs of digital marketers and SEO professionals. While each platform has its strengths and areas of improvement, the decision ultimately rests on the unique requirements and objectives of the user. By considering factors such as pricing, features, usability, data accuracy, support, and performance, individuals and businesses can make an informed choice to leverage the best tool for achieving their digital marketing goals in 2024 and beyond.



Like Article
Suggest improvement
Previous
Next
Share your thoughts in the comments

Similar Reads